  • The Ministry of Social Justice & Empowerment launches the Atal Vayo Abhyuday Yojana to empower senior citizens in India.
  • The Atal Vayo Abhyuday Yojana (AVYAY) is a scheme launched by the Ministry of Social Justice and Empowerment in India to empower senior citizens and ensure their well-being and social inclusion.
  • It is a Central Sector Scheme, which is formerly known as National Action Plan for Senior Citizens.
  • Its vision is to create a society where senior citizens live healthy, happy and empowered life.
  • The scheme aims to address the financial, healthcare, and social needs of elderly citizens, recognizing their valuable contributions to society.
